Transaction 6510fd3d6e84b405843b21b5f9822cea90641425882540aebe1e8f8696750740
1 Input
2 Outputs
- 6510fd3d6e84b405843b21b5f9822cea90641425882540aebe1e8f8696750740:0
- 6510fd3d6e84b405843b21b5f9822cea90641425882540aebe1e8f8696750740:1
value 27317
address 1Q1CSSSF9zpeFM8QiAvwnAEHuVafuuyRC4
value 315884
address 1CkzDvaoFBkBKs1xXNjjU1kBCNGjeFkDCW